Students in the PhD Program in Social Welfare at the CUNY Graduate Center work closely with leading faculty from throughout CUNY on research that is personally meaningful and that addresses important issues in social work practice and policy. We prepare graduates to carry out social work’s historic role in developing effective change at the individual, agency, community, national, and international levels.
